BERLIN, September 8 (RIA Novosti) - Russian President Vladimir Putin and German Chancellor Gerhard Schroeder adopted a joint statement on cooperation in the energy sector Thursday.
"The parties find it necessary to pursue a coordinated policy in the energy sector that would secure the continuity of supply, commercial viability and ecological cleanness," the document says.
The parties are making efforts to develop and use Russian natural gas resources and expand the necessary pipeline infrastructure.
